新中国成立以来,确立了以公有制为基础的电影生产体制,在文化上也开始塑造以工农兵为主体的人民电影。工农大众是20世纪中国文艺作品中出现的一种特殊的主体和人物形象,其显影和消隐与20世纪中国社会主义革命的兴衰有着密切关系。工人、农民顾名思义是从事工业生产和农业劳作的人,他们不只是一种行业身份和社会职业,还是一种群众运动和人民革命的阶级主体。在现代工业社会中,工农是默默无闻的乌合之众,是被损害、被侮辱和被同情的对象。而在20
